In its recent earnings report, GoDaddy Inc. reported strong financial results for the fourth quarter and full year 2024, demonstrating a consistent pattern of profitable growth. The company achieved a total revenue of $4.6 billion for the year, an 8% increase from the previous year, and highlighted significant advancements in strategic initiatives, particularly around its GoDaddy Airo platform.
Key financial metrics from 2024 reveal a robust performance, with total bookings reaching $5 billion, a 9% year-over-year increase. Despite a 32% decline in net income to $936.9 million due to a non-routine tax benefit in 2023, GoDaddy’s normalized EBITDA surged by 23% to $1.4 billion, showcasing strong operational efficiency. Additionally, the company’s free cash flow grew by 25% to $1.4 billion, while gross payments volume from its commerce offerings increased by 55% to $2.6 billion.
In terms of strategic developments, GoDaddy expanded its AI-powered GoDaddy Airo experience with new features and supported the WordPress community with a donation and enhanced hosting services. These efforts underline GoDaddy’s commitment to innovation and customer value creation.
Looking ahead, GoDaddy’s management remains optimistic about 2025, targeting a revenue growth of around 7% and expecting further enhancements in EBITDA margins.
